Trace-element analysis of obsidian artifacts from Pachamachay, Junín
Prehistoric hunters of the high Andes, by John W. Rick • New York • Published In 1980 • Pages: 257-261
By: Burger, Richard L..
AbstractBrief abstract written by HRAF anthropologists who have done the subject indexing for the document
Burger ran X-ray flourescence analysis on obsidian flakes from Pachamachay. One obsidian flake came from preceramic level 23. The results of the analysis were that the source of the obsidian is unknown and it is 'postulated to be the product of a nearby volcanic formation that failed to produce a widely utilized obsidian.' (page 259).
